Massachusetts Code § 146-88

Refrigeration technicians, inapplicability of provisions

Section 88. The provisions of sections eighty-one to eighty-six, inclusive, relative to the examining and licensing of refrigeration technicians, contractors or trainees shall not apply to the installation, replacement, maintenance or alteration of any air conditioning or refrigeration systems, including apparatus or equipment, covered under the provisions of this chapter as are found on the premises or property of such industrial plant, public or private utility company, firm, corporation, hospital, school or college, by a person regularly in the employ of such industrial plant, public or private utility company, firm, corporation, hospital, school or college.
